What is Zlookup?

Zlookup is a free reverse-phone-lookup website that returns owner and carrier information, with a focus on being genuinely free.

Zlookup describes its lookups as 'entirely free' and lists support for numbers in 195+ countries. (Zlookup official site)

Where Zlookup is strong

  • Free reverse lookup with no paywall
  • Simple, no-frills interface
  • Decent results for US numbers

Where it falls short

  • A separate website to visit
  • Best coverage is US-focused
  • Identity focus rather than 'is it safe to reply?'
